Tips to Improve Mobile Website Speed

Having a fast-loading website is crucial for providing a great user experience, especially on mobile devices where connection speeds can be slower. Here are some tips to help you improve the speed of your mobile website:

1. Optimize images

Images are often one of the biggest culprits of slow-loading websites. Make sure to optimize your images by reducing their file size without compromising quality. Use image compression tools or consider using responsive images that are automatically resized based on the device’s screen size.

2. Minimize HTTP requests

Each HTTP request made to load a resource, such as CSS, JavaScript, or images, adds to the loading time. Minimize the number of HTTP requests by combining multiple style sheets into one file, using CSS sprites for icons and small images, and leveraging browser caching to reduce the need for repeated requests.

3. Use a content delivery network (CDN)

A CDN is a network of servers distributed geographically that help deliver your website’s content faster. By hosting your static assets, such as images, JavaScript, and CSS files, on a CDN, you can reduce the distance between the user and the server, resulting in faster loading times.

4. Enable browser caching

Browser caching allows web pages to be stored in a user’s browser, reducing the need to fetch them from the server for subsequent visits. Set proper caching headers to control how long certain resources should be cached, taking care to balance caching duration with the need for up-to-date content.

5. Minify and combine CSS and JavaScript files

Reduce the size of your CSS and JavaScript files by minifying them, which involves removing unnecessary characters, such as spaces, line breaks, and comments. Additionally, consider combining multiple CSS and JavaScript files into one file to reduce the number of requests the browser needs to make.

6. Reduce server response time

A slow server response time can significantly affect your website’s speed. Optimize your server by using caching techniques, minimizing database queries, and implementing server-side performance optimizations. Consider upgrading your hosting plan if necessary.

7. Optimize above-the-fold content

Ensure that the essential content of your page, also known as above-the-fold content, loads quickly. Prioritize the loading of critical resources, such as text and images, and defer the loading of non-essential elements, such as third-party scripts or less important images.

8. Monitor and test your site speed regularly

Regularly monitor your mobile website’s speed using tools such as Google’s Mobile Site Speed Test. Test various pages and sections of your site to identify areas that need improvement. Continuously measure and optimize your site speed to provide the best possible experience for your mobile users.

By following these tips, you can significantly improve the speed of your mobile website, resulting in happier users and potentially higher conversion rates.

Optimizing Images for Mobile

Images play a crucial role in enhancing the overall user experience of a website. However, if they are not optimized for mobile devices, they can significantly impact the performance of your site.

When it comes to mobile site speed, Google considers image optimization to be one of the key factors. By optimizing your images for mobile devices, you can ensure faster page load times and better performance on mobile.

Here are some tips to optimize images for mobile:

  1. Resize and compress your images: Before uploading images to your website, make sure to resize them to the appropriate dimensions. Large images can slow down page load times on mobile devices. Additionally, compressing the images optimizes the file size without compromising on visual quality.
  2. Choose the correct file format: Selecting the right file format for your images is essential for mobile optimization. For photographs and colorful images, JPEG format is typically the best option. On the other hand, for graphics and logos with transparent backgrounds, PNG format is recommended.
  3. Enable lazy loading: Implement lazy loading for your images, especially those located below the fold. This technique ensures that images are only loaded when the user scrolls to them, reducing the initial page load time.
  4. Use responsive images: Implement responsive images on your website to automatically adjust the image size based on the user’s device and screen resolution. This helps to deliver the optimal image size without affecting the image quality.
  5. Consider using a content delivery network (CDN): Utilizing a CDN can improve the delivery of your images by serving them from the network’s edge servers. This reduces the distance between the user and the server, resulting in faster load times.

By implementing these image optimization techniques, you can significantly improve the mobile performance of your website. Remember, a fast and responsive website not only enhances user experience but also boosts your search engine rankings.

Minifying CSS and JavaScript

One effective strategy to improve the performance of your website on Google’s mobile site speed test is to minify your CSS and JavaScript files. Minifying these files means removing unnecessary characters such as spaces, line breaks, and comments without affecting the functionality of the code.

Minifying CSS and JavaScript can significantly reduce the file size, leading to faster loading times and improved website performance. Smaller file sizes result in quicker downloads, especially on mobile devices with limited bandwidth.

There are several tools available to minify CSS and JavaScript files. Google itself provides tools like the PageSpeed Insights, which can automatically minify your code and provide recommendations for further optimization.

Another popular tool for minifying files is Google Closure Compiler. It analyzes your code and removes unnecessary characters while also applying advanced compression techniques. This can result in even smaller file sizes and better performance.

When minifying CSS and JavaScript files, it’s important to test the changes on your website. Make sure to check for any compatibility issues or potential errors that may arise due to the minification process. Additionally, regularly retest your website using Google’s mobile site speed test to verify the improvements in performance.

In conclusion, minifying CSS and JavaScript files is an effective way to improve the speed and performance of your website on Google’s mobile site speed test. By reducing file size, you can enhance the user experience and ensure faster loading times for your pages.

Enabling Browser Caching

Browser caching allows the mobile site to store certain elements such as images, scripts, and stylesheets in a user’s device after visiting a webpage. This means that when the user returns to the website, their browser can retrieve these stored elements instead of having to download them again. Enabling browser caching can significantly improve the performance of your website, especially on mobile devices.

By taking advantage of browser caching, you can reduce the number of HTTP requests made by a user’s browser, which in turn reduces the load time of your pages. This is because the browser doesn’t need to download the same resources multiple times if they are cached locally. The result is a faster and more efficient browsing experience for your mobile users.

How to Enable Browser Caching

Enabling browser caching involves setting an expiration date or timestamp for each resource on your website. This tells the user’s browser when it can safely retrieve the resource from its cache instead of requesting it from the server. To accomplish this, you can use HTTP caching headers such as “Expires” and “Cache-Control” in your server’s response headers.

Additionally, you can also set the “ETag” header, which provides a unique identifier for a resource. The ETag allows the browser to check if the resource has changed since it was last cached, ensuring that the most up-to-date version is always retrieved.

The Benefits of Enabling Browser Caching

Enabling browser caching has several benefits for both your website and your users:

  • Improved load times: By reducing the number of HTTP requests and retrieving resources from the cache, your website’s pages will load faster, especially on mobile devices.
  • Bandwidth savings: With browser caching enabled, your website will consume less bandwidth as returning users won’t need to download the same resources again.
  • Better user experience: Faster load times and reduced page loading, especially on mobile devices, contribute to a smoother and more enjoyable browsing experience for your users.

Overall, enabling browser caching is a crucial step in optimizing your website’s performance, particularly on mobile devices. By reducing load times and saving bandwidth, you can improve the user experience and keep your visitors engaged with your mobile site.

Using a Content Delivery Network (CDN)

One effective way to improve the performance of your website and enhance site speed is by utilizing a Content Delivery Network (CDN). CDNs are a network of servers located in different geographical locations worldwide that store a cached version of your website’s content.

When a user visits your website, the CDN will serve the content from the server closest to them, reducing the latency and increasing the website’s speed. Google recommends using a CDN to deliver your website’s content, especially for mobile devices.

By utilizing a CDN, your website can benefit from reduced server load and decreased bandwidth usage. This ultimately leads to faster loading times, improved user experience, and higher search engine rankings.

When setting up a CDN for your website, make sure to choose a reputable provider that offers good coverage across various locations, reliable performance, and excellent technical support. It’s also important to ensure that the CDN seamlessly integrates with your website and supports the necessary technologies, such as SSL certificates.

Benefits of using a CDN:

  1. Improved website performance: As mentioned earlier, delivering content from servers located closer to your users reduces latency and speeds up page loading times.
  2. Faster content delivery: By distributing your website’s content across multiple servers, a CDN reduces the distance data needs to travel, resulting in faster content delivery to users around the world.
  3. Better user experience: Websites that load quickly provide a better user experience, reducing bounce rates, increasing engagement, and potentially leading to higher conversion rates.
  4. Reduced server load: With a CDN in place, your origin server is relieved of the burden of serving static content, allowing it to focus on delivering dynamic content and improving overall website performance.
  5. Global scalability: CDNs have a global network of servers, making it easier to scale your website’s performance as your user base grows and ensuring smooth website operation during traffic spikes.

In conclusion, integrating a Content Delivery Network (CDN) into your website can greatly enhance its performance, improve site speed, and ultimately provide a better user experience. Take advantage of the benefits offered by CDNs to optimize your website for both desktop and mobile platforms.
